1. Location

Location exerts a major affect on the worth and desirability of St. Martin Caribbean property. The island’s numerous geography provides quite a lot of settings, every with distinct traits. Coastal areas, notably these with beachfront entry, command premium costs. Orient Bay, with its vibrant environment and intensive seashore, exemplifies this development. Equally, the tranquil shores of Grand Case, identified for its upscale eating, entice discerning patrons. Conversely, properties positioned additional inland, whereas usually extra inexpensive, supply totally different benefits, equivalent to panoramic views and higher privateness. The hillsides of Colombier, for example, present gorgeous vistas and a way of seclusion. The proximity to facilities, equivalent to marinas, procuring facilities, and airports, additionally performs a vital function in figuring out property values. Properties close to the Princess Juliana Worldwide Airport in Simpson Bay profit from handy entry, whereas these nestled in quieter communities like Terres Basses supply a extra secluded retreat.

4. Authorized Concerns

Navigating the authorized panorama related to property acquisition in St. Martin is essential for a safe and profitable transaction. The island’s dual-nationality standing, encompassing each French and Dutch authorized programs, provides complexity to the method. Understanding the distinct rules and procedures relevant to every facet of the island is crucial for safeguarding investments and making certain compliance with native legal guidelines. Due diligence {and professional} authorized counsel are indispensable for navigating these intricacies.

  • Twin-Nationality Complexity

    St. Martin’s distinctive standing as a dual-nation island introduces distinct authorized frameworks governing property possession. The French facet (Saint-Martin) adheres to French legislation, whereas the Dutch facet (Sint Maarten) operates below Dutch legislation. This distinction necessitates cautious consideration of the relevant authorized system relying on the property’s location. Participating authorized specialists accustomed to each programs is crucial for navigating the complexities of property transactions and making certain compliance with related rules.

  • Property Switch Procedures

    Property switch procedures differ between the French and Dutch sides of the island. On the French facet, notaries play a central function in overseeing the switch of possession, making certain authorized compliance and verifying documentation. On the Dutch facet, the method sometimes includes attorneys and the Kadaster, the land registry workplace. Understanding these procedural nuances is essential for making certain a easy and legally sound transaction. Correct documentation and adherence to particular necessities are important for avoiding delays and potential authorized challenges.

7. Foreign money Change

Foreign money alternate performs a major function in St. Martin/Sint Maarten actual property transactions because of the island’s dual-nationality standing. The French facet (Saint-Martin) operates utilizing the euro (EUR), whereas the Dutch facet (Sint Maarten) primarily makes use of the Netherlands Antillean guilder (ANG), although US {dollars} are extensively accepted. This dual-currency system introduces complexities for property patrons and sellers, impacting property valuations, transaction prices, and ongoing bills. Understanding these forex dynamics is essential for making knowledgeable funding selections and managing monetary elements of property possession.

Property costs are sometimes listed within the forex comparable to the facet of the island the place the property is positioned. A villa listed in euros on the French facet would require changing funds from different currencies, equivalent to US {dollars} or Canadian {dollars}, if the customer is utilizing funds originating from accounts denominated in these currencies. Equally, buying a condominium listed in guilders on the Dutch facet necessitates conversion from different currencies. These conversions introduce alternate fee danger, as fluctuations in forex values can influence the ultimate buy value. As an example, a sudden appreciation of the euro in opposition to the greenback may improve the efficient price for a US dollar-based purchaser buying property on the French facet. Conversely, a weakening of the guilder in opposition to the euro may create a extra favorable buying alternative for a euro-based purchaser on the Dutch facet.
